N°02Common West Palm Beach AC repairs

What we see most often.

Capacitor failure

$180–260

The #1 summer repair in Florida. Your outdoor fan hums but won't spin, or the compressor won't start. 20-minute fix, 2-year warranty.

Refrigerant leak + recharge

$350–700

AC blowing warm, ice on the evaporator coil. We find the leak, seal or replace the line, recharge to spec with R-410A or R-22 (if system pre-2010).

Blower motor

$650–950

No airflow from vents, thermostat calls but nothing moves. Replace motor + capacitor + belt. Includes commissioning.

Condenser fan motor

$500–750

Outdoor unit vibrates, compressor overheats, system shuts off on thermal protection. Replace motor + contactor as a pair.

Thermostat replacement

$180–350

Display blank, unresponsive, or miscalibrated. We install a new programmable or smart thermostat (Honeywell / Ecobee / Nest) and configure it.

Contactor + hard-start kit

$200–320

System trips breaker on startup, loud click from outdoor unit. Replace contactor, add hard-start capacitor kit for longer compressor life.

N°03Repair or replace?

Honest math, both ways.

Repair makes sense if
  • • System is under 10 years old
  • • Single component failure (capacitor, motor, contactor)
  • • Uses R-410A refrigerant (not R-22)
  • • Repair quote is under $1,500
  • • You plan to move within 2 years
Replace makes sense if
  • • System is 12+ years old
  • • Uses R-22 refrigerant (discontinued 2020)
  • • Repair quote exceeds $2,000
  • • Multiple components failing in same year
  • • Humidity / comfort already bad pre-failure
